The MA Journalism, Media and Communications course at Cardiff University is a year-long, full-time program designed to equip students with a robust and critical understanding of the media industry's shifting multidisciplinary landscape. The program delves deep into issues concerning democracy, citizenship, and cultural politics, linked to journalism and public communications globally.Course Content: The degree content concentrates on the transformations in communication practices and policies which have ushered in a new global era. It launches a thorough examination of key themes such as digital democracy, information and communications policy, diverse and changing media, digital cultures, and transformations in political and public communication.Key Modules: They include Journalism Studies, Public Relations, Political Communication, and International Communications. You also have the opportunity to explore modules from across the School of Journalism, Media and Culture’s Master's program.Accreditations: The course is recognized by the Economic and Social Research Council (ESRC) for use in funding applications for a 1+3 postgraduate study.Future Careers: The program is designed to train future academics and researchers in the field of media and communications.
